Essential oils, used for fragrance and specific benefits like growth stimulation or anti-inflammatory properties, are the second critical layer. Applying too much is a common mistake; a little goes a long way.
This ensures that the hair is conditioned and the follicles are nourished. Jojoba oil is often considered the gold standard due to its molecular structure, which closely resembles human sebum, making it highly compatible and non-comedogenic.
